Question Posted Saturday March 15 2008, 12:36 pm

Alright, I have an advice column on here: DepthofHeart, but my password wasn't working so I reset it on the lost password thing and it said it would send a new one to my e-mail address. It hasn't yet and I've done it three times over the past two weeks, so I can't log in.

DangerNerd answered Saturday March 15 2008, 7:34 pm:
Hello there,

Please do it, then check your spam/junk folder.

The mails are being sent out just fine.

Let me know if I can do anything for you.
